Augustus Muller, a.k.a. Gus of Boy Harsher, has shared his latest single “Perverse Technology,” off of his upcoming album Cellulosed Bodies, out September 1 via Nude Club Records. The album features two original scores, “Crash” and “Automaton,” which are set to be featured in filmmaker and pornographer Vex Ashley’s upcoming film “Four Chambers.”
On the album, Muller experiments with nu disco and various vocal samples to produce an industrial yet pop oriented atmosphere. “Perverse Technology” immerses the listeners into a dark and sensual atmosphere characterized by droning synths.
